    Abstract: The present invention generally relates to a cooking oven, which is provided with a cooking cavity and a door adapted to close the cooking cavity. The door is provided with an outer frame and one or more glass panes supported by such frame along the periphery thereof. On the surface of at least one of the glass panes there are applied heating means, which include a layer of substantially clear, e.g. transparent resistive material, and means adapted to connect two sides of such layer of resistive material to appropriate terminals energizable by an electric voltage supplied from a source available inside the oven.

  • Patent number: 8089981
    Abstract: MAC addresses of information devices on a network are collected using a broadcast frame or multicast frame of Ethernet®. If duplicate MAC addresses are detected, an Ethernet® frame, including a device identifier of information device and a MAC address to be set, is sent by broadcast transmission or multicast transmission. The information devices receiving this Ethernet® frame compare the above device identifier with their own device identifiers. If they match, the MAC address is changed to that designated. Duplicate MAC addresses are thus resolved, enabling correct Ethernet® communications.
